An Enclosure Matters More for Certain Filaments and Home Environments Than Others

Whether an enclosure is worth the extra cost or DIY effort depends on what you're printing and where, if you stick to PLA in a stable room, an open-frame printer performs fine, if you plan to print ABS, nylon, or other warping-prone materials, or your printer sits somewhere drafty, an enclosure meaningfully improves print reliability and reduces fume exposure.

Some Printer Frames Hold Calibration Longer Than Others Between Prints

A 3D printer's frame rigidity affects how often you need to re-level or re-calibrate between prints, a sturdier frame (often aluminum extrusion with cross-bracing) holds calibration across many prints, while a lighter or less rigid frame can shift enough during transport or vibration to need frequent re-leveling, check build quality reviews if you want to minimize recurring calibration maintenance.

Standard Brass Nozzles Wear Out Quickly on Abrasive Filaments

Filament abrasiveness is a real factor most first-time buyers overlook, a brass nozzle wears out quickly under carbon-fiber or metal-infused filaments, gradually widening and degrading print accuracy, if abrasive materials are part of your plan, budget for a hardened steel or ruby nozzle upgrade rather than assuming the stock brass nozzle will hold up.

Check Build Volume Against Your Actual Largest Planned Print, Not the Average

Don't buy a 3D printer sized exactly to your largest planned print, the stated build volume is a hard maximum and real prints need edge clearance and calibration margin, if you'll regularly print near that ceiling, choose a printer with meaningfully more build volume than your typical largest project.

Automatic Bed Leveling Saves Real Setup Time Over Manual Leveling

A 3D printer with automatic bed leveling uses a sensor to map the print bed's surface and compensate for minor unevenness before each print, a genuine time-saver over manual leveling, which requires physically adjusting screws at each corner and re-checking with a feeler gauge, auto-leveling isn't perfect and doesn't replace an occasional manual check, but it removes a real recurring maintenance task for frequent printing.

Frequently Asked Questions

Should I print at the printer's maximum advertised speed?

Usually not for best quality, max speed often introduces visible ringing or dimensional drift, most users get better results dialing back somewhat from the advertised ceiling.

Do I need an enclosed 3D printer?

Only if you plan to print warping-prone materials like ABS or nylon, or your room is drafty, PLA in a stable room works fine on an open-frame printer.

Are 3D printers loud?

It varies significantly by model, quieter stepper drivers and fan designs make a real difference, check specific noise-level reviews if the printer will run somewhere you spend time like a bedroom or office.

Is a multi-material system worth it?

Only if you regularly print multi-color or multi-material objects, each filament switch wastes purge material and adds print time, single-color prints get no benefit from the feature.

What happens if filament runs out mid-print?

Without a filament run-out sensor, the print simply fails and wastes everything printed so far, this matters most for long unattended prints, check for this feature if you run extended jobs.

Is automatic bed leveling worth paying extra for?

It saves real recurring setup time if you print frequently, manual leveling requires adjusting corner screws and checking with a feeler gauge before nearly every session.
